Jerome & Kevin Present – Cancelled Too Soon: GLOW (Season 2)

Season 2 of GLOW came at an interesting time. As Jerome and Kevin discuss the season, they also discuss how the #MeToo movement happening in modern day was reflected in a show taking place in the 1980s.

They also talk about improvements from the first season and other things they wish could have been improved, a couple of new additions to the cast, what story elements could’ve been omitted, and why Jerome seems Hulk Hogan and Bret Hart in the two main characters.

Jerome & Kevin Present – Cancelled Too Soon: GLOW (Season 1)

It’s finally time for the Cancelled Too Soon series to come to an end. What better way to do so then for Jerome and Kevin to discuss the very topic that started their podcasting relationship – professional wrestling? 

Today’s episode marks the first part of the Cancelled Too Soon finale, discussing Season 1 of Netflix’s GLOW. First, there’s talks of what the hosts knew about the actual GLOW wrestling promotion before watching the show and how women’s wrestling was viewed in the 1980s. Then they talk about the 2012 documentary about GLOW and how that birthed the Netflix series. Talks of the show itself centers mostly around the characters and how successful the show was at balancing the ensemble cast.

Sprinkled amongst the discussion are talks of bad wigs and costuming, wrestling venues and fans, and comparison to actual wrestlers.
